Domaine Bouzereau Gruere
Domaine Bouzereau Gruere
Founded in 1970 by Hubert Bouzereau, a seventh-generation winemaker from Meursault,
and his wife Marie-France Gruère, hailing from Chassagne-Montrachet, this family estate
combines two historic winemaking heritages. Since 2001, their daughters, Marie-Laure
and Marie-Anne, have joined the domaine, creating Domaine Hubert Bouzereau-
Gruère & Filles.
The 10-hectare estate spans six villages in the Côte de Beaune, producing
predominantly white wines, including Meursault, Puligny-Montrachet, and Chassagne-
Montrachet. Focused on soil management, yield control, and balanced oak aging, the
domaine crafts wines of concentration, purity, and freshness.
